Artificial Intelligence Improving the Carrier Industry

The carrier industry is a critical backbone of the nation’s economy, but an alarming rise in traffic accidents has also plagued it. According to the National Highway Traffic Safety Administration (NHTSA), 2021 marked the highest number of traffic deaths in 16 years, with truck crashes increasing by a staggering 13% year over year. The impact of these accidents extends far beyond statistics, with countless lives affected by the consequences. In 2022, the NHTSA revealed even more sobering data, showing that approximately 43,000 people lost their lives in motor vehicle accidents.

A paradigm shift is needed to address these growing safety concerns on our roads. Artificial Intelligence (AI) has the potential to be the transformative force that the carrier industry in Decatur, IL, desperately needs. By leveraging AI-driven solutions, the carrier industry can proactively address the root causes of accidents, enhancing Safety on the road. AI can also help cut down on fuel costs, improve productivity, indicate when maintenance is needed, and aid safety managers with coaching.

Fuel Savings

Fuel costs are a significant concern for carriers, impacting both the bottom line and environmental sustainability. AI-driven systems excel in efficient route planning, optimizing journeys to minimize travel time and maximize fuel efficiency. These systems consider a multitude of variables, including traffic data and weather conditions, to chart the most fuel-efficient path. If unexpected conditions arise, such as traffic congestion or adverse weather, AI can swiftly adjust routes to provide a new optimal path, ensuring that carriers in Decatur, IL, stay on track and save on fuel costs. But AI’s fuel-saving prowess goes beyond route planning. It dives deep into analyzing load weight, road conditions, and driving behaviors. By continuously monitoring these factors, Artificial Intelligence can fine-tune driving strategies to reduce fuel usage.

Accident Prevention

In the carrier industry, Safety is vital, and preventing accidents is extremely important. One of the standout features of AI in accident prevention is its ability to provide real-time accident alerts. Dash cameras equipped with AI can identify concerning behaviors in surrounding motorists, such as frequent distractions or driving at concerning speeds. This real-time monitoring enables drivers to anticipate and respond to potential risks posed by others on the road, reducing the likelihood of accidents caused by reckless driving. AI also uses sensors and cameras to assess the road ahead and actively intervene if a collision risk is detected.

Whether it’s applying the brakes or steering to avoid an obstacle, collision avoidance systems provide an additional layer of protection, helping drivers navigate complex traffic situations safely. Adaptive cruise control, another AI-enabled feature, helps maintain a safe following distance from vehicles ahead. It automatically adjusts the vehicle’s speed to match the flow of traffic, reducing the risk of rear-end collisions. Lane departure warnings further contribute to accident prevention by alerting drivers when they unintentionally veer out of their lane, preventing accidents caused by lane drift.

Preventative Maintenance

Preventative maintenance is the backbone of a well-functioning carrier fleet. AI systems, equipped with sensors and advanced analytics, continuously monitor engine performance, tire conditions, and fluid levels in real time. This constant vigilance allows AI to detect even the slightest deviations from optimal operating conditions. When an issue or maintenance need is identified, AI sends immediate alerts to the carrier or maintenance team. These alerts enable carriers to take proactive measures, scheduling maintenance or repairs before a minor issue escalates into a major, costly breakdown.

One of the key advantages of AI-driven preventative maintenance is its ability to tailor alerts based on the specific needs of each vehicle. For example, if an engine is showing signs of overheating or decreased efficiency, Artificial Intelligence can send an alert with precise recommendations for maintenance, ensuring that the issue is addressed promptly and efficiently. Targeted Coaching

Safety managers play a pivotal role in ensuring that drivers adhere to the highest safety standards on the road. Artificial Intelligence is empowering these safety managers with invaluable tools that provide visibility into driver behaviors while offering personalized coaching, recognition, and incident management.

AI equips safety managers with a comprehensive view of driver behaviors through real-time monitoring and data analysis. This newfound visibility allows safety managers to customize their coaching efforts, tailoring them to each driver’s specific needs for improvement. Whether it is addressing issues related to speeding, harsh braking, or distracted driving, AI provides safety managers with actionable insights to help drivers enhance their safety performance. Accidents are an unfortunate reality on the road, but AI ensures that safety managers are well-prepared to respond promptly.

When accidents occur, AI immediately alerts safety managers, allowing them to aid drivers and initiate insurance claims when necessary. AI can also offer incident playback, providing a visual representation of how the accident transpired. This playback can serve as critical evidence in cases where the driver is not at fault, helping expedite insurance claims and clear the driver’s record of responsibility.
